Double-line type distributor with quantitative distribution function
By employing a combination of metal tubing and flexible hose in the dual-line distributor, and utilizing threaded connections and sealing ring design, the problem of inconvenient angle adjustment of the quick-connect plug is solved, enabling flexible adjustment of angle and position, ensuring sealing, and improving the performance.

The angle of the quick-connect socket on the existing two-wire splitter is inconvenient to adjust, which cannot meet the usage requirements.
A quantitative dispensing dual-line dispenser was designed, which adopts a combination structure of metal tube and hose. The angle can be adjusted by threaded connection and sealing ring. The hose is made of rubber and can be deformed to meet the connection requirements of different angles.
It enables flexible adjustment of the quick-connect angle and position, ensuring that the sealing performance is not affected, meeting the needs of multi-angle connection, and providing good performance.

TECHNICAL FIELD
[0001] The utility model relates to cable bridge technical field especially, it is a kind of quantitative distribution's double-wire type distributor. BACKGROUND
[0002] Double-wire distributor is a kind of distributor, distributor has two oil inlets, when one of them is supplied by lubricating pump, the other is open to oil reservoir. Double-wire distributor includes multiple outlets or multiple adjusting rods, adjusting rod is matched with corresponding outlet, for controlling the oil output of outlet.
[0003] The existing outlet is simply quick connector, in actual use, due to various factors, the angle position of quick connector is inconvenient to adjust, cannot satisfy the use demand. CONTENT OF UTILITY MODEL

[0021] Embodiment one
[0022] As shown in Figure 1 , Figure 2 , the utility model provides a double -line type dispenser of quantitative distribution, including dispenser main body 1, two inlets 11 are arranged on the side of dispenser main body 1, the top of dispenser main body 1 is provided with a plurality of outlets 2 and a plurality of adjusting rods 12, adjusting rod 12 is matched with outlet 2, a plurality of outlets 2 are all screw -threaded with metal pipe 3, the top of metal pipe 3 is fixedly installed with quick connector 4.
[0023] In this embodiment, the bottom end of metal pipe 3 is welded with internal thread pipe 31, the top end of outlet 2 is welded with external thread pipe 21, external thread pipe 21 is screw -threaded with internal thread pipe 31, the outside of metal pipe 3 is provided with rubber sleeve, the friction of holding metal pipe 3 can be improved through rubber sleeve, and the outside of metal pipe 3 can be protected.
[0024] In this embodiment, the working mode is: the two inlets 11 are used for oil inlet, the plurality of outlets 2 are used for oil outlet, the metal pipe 3 is guided into through the hose 6, then is discharged through the quick connector 4, the quick connector 4 is used for connecting machine, realizes the purpose of oil injection, the two sealing rings 61 are arranged between the hose 6 and the metal pipe 3, and the normal use is not affected.
[0025] Embodiment two
[0026] This embodiment is further optimized on the basis of embodiment one, and the same parts as the foregoing technical solutions will not be described here, as shown in Figure 3 , Figure 4 , to better realize the utility model, in particular the following setting mode is adopted: in this embodiment, the metal pipe 3 sealing piston is provided with an adapter pipe structure, the adapter pipe structure includes a hose 6, the bottom end of the hose 6 is fixedly installed with an inner ring of the external thread pipe 21, the top opening of the hose 6 is fixedly installed with two sealing rings 61, the two sealing rings 61 are slidably connected with the inner wall of the metal pipe 3, the two sealing rings 61 can improve the sealing property between the hose 6 and the inner wall of the metal pipe 3, and the outer side of the sealing ring 61 is arc-shaped, which can facilitate the sliding of the sealing ring 61 on the inner wall of the metal pipe 3.
[0027] In the embodiment, the outer side of the hose 6 is fixedly sleeved with an outer threaded ring 51, the inner side of the bottom opening of the metal pipe 3 is fixedly installed with an inner threaded ring 5, the inner threaded ring 5 is threadedly connected with the outer threaded ring 51, and the hose 6 is made of rubber and can be deformed.
[0028] In the embodiment, in the working mode, when the angle of oil outlet needs to be adjusted, the metal pipe 3 is rotated, the inner threaded pipe 31 and the outer threaded pipe 21 are detached, the metal pipe 3 can be separated from the outlet 2, then the metal pipe 3 is pulled outward, both of the sealing rings 61 slide on the inner wall of the metal pipe 3, until the outer threaded ring 51 contacts with the inner threaded ring 5, then the outer threaded ring 51 is threadedly connected with the inner threaded ring 5, the metal pipe 3, the hose 6 and the outlet 2 are communicated, since the hose 6 is made of rubber and can be deformed and bent, the angle and position of the quick connector 4 can be adjusted, the connection of different angles can be satisfied, the use effect is good, when not in use, the metal pipe 3 is directly connected with the outlet 2 by reverse operation.
